Update On Edge’s Contract Status

By The Spotlight StaffOctober 1, 2023
Update On Edge's Contract Status

WWE Hall of Famer Edge wrestled his final match on his contract against Sheamus on the August 18th episode of SmackDown. A day before the bout, Edge confirmed that his contract would expire in September.

Edge’s contract has now expired. This means he is officially a free agent. As of now, a lot of rumors circulate on social media regarding Edge’s next move. Many expect him to debut tonight at AEW WrestleDream.

The Rated R Superstar can appear in any wrestling promotion. However, Edge can’t use his WWE’s stage name.

It’s worth noting that last August, Edge posted a video on X and revealed that he and WWE are on good terms. The company has offered him a contract extension.

“I didn’t come at them with some crazy contract or anything, and they didn’t deny me. I have a contract extension sitting in my inbox. I just don’t know what to do…”
